Performance Opportunities
Students may opt-in to perform in mainstage productions alongside the professional dancers of Ballet Co.Laboratory twice a year. Repertoire (rehearsal) is built into the class schedule. Additional fees apply with opt-in.

BEGINNING BALLET
Ages 6 - 7 Level Color: Light Blue | 1.5 hours per week
In this class, dancers begin exploring the fundamentals of ballet technique. Dancers will learn the basic stance and placement for ballet technique and start to translate this into exercises at the barre, in the center, and across the floor. This class will also focus on the connection of music and movement.

LEVEL I
Ages 7 - 9 Level Color: Seafoam Green | 2 hours per week
In Level I, students solidify ballet class etiquette, build muscles to support correct posture and alignment, and broaden their understanding and execution of ballet technique. This class also begins to study modern dance to support versatility within their dance training.

LEVEL II
Ages 9 - 11 Level Color: Maroon | 4.75 hours per week
Level II students continue to expand their ballet class etiquette, stance, and strength. Dancers will learn longer combinations with more complicated steps to increase memory capability and coordination. Dancers will begin conditioning training while continuing to study character and modern dance.
